当前位置: 首页 > 网络应用技术

如何使用Django-CMS(2023年的最新饰面)

时间:2023-03-06 16:53:50 网络应用技术

  指南:本文的首席执行官注释将介绍有关如何使用Django-CMS的相关内容。我希望这对每个人都会有所帮助。让我们来看看。

  它并没有说Django-CMS是一个内容管理系统,而是它实际上是一个基本的开发平台。不像常规CMS,Django-CMS不是包装盒中使用的产品,也不提供许多内置模板和主题,允许用户快速构建一个网站。相反,可以使用Django-CMS要求用户熟悉Django,其构造过程非常“像”,这是与Django一起开发的过程。

  本文总结了一日文档阅读经验。

  从结构上讲,django-cms包含以下内容:

  1.基本框架:

  多站点支持 - 嗯,实际上是django

  多语言支持。没有不同语言的页面。

  页面管理。后台视觉支持,包括页面结构和插件(插件)的配置

  可扩展菜单系统

  集成/继承从Django模板系统。ADD占位符。

  基于插件的扩展机制的集成-Django应用程序(APP)。

  2.一组插件

  文件

  文本

  谷歌地图

  推特

  闪光

  视频

  3.一组模板标签

  show_menu

  show_breadcrumb

  show_submenu

  占位符

  ... ... ...

  4,其他

  SEO支持

  虚拟根(软根)

  站点地图

  (内容)版本历史记录功能

  Em

  在使用方面,Django-CMS的主要客户应该是程序员,而不是最终用户或设计师。这是由其部署过程确定的。当使用Django-CMS开发网站时,通常随后是以下步骤:

  使用标准的django-admin.py startproject建立标准Django项目

  modify settings.py,installed_apps添加了CMS,菜单和其他插件,Template_Context_Processors,语言和其他CMS_MOCKS。

  使用manage.py syncdb生成数据库

  开发模板和样式

  manage.py runserver启动

  然后使用背景系统构建目标网站结构

  如果您发现无法满足需求,则可以访问Django-CMS网站以检查插件库或根据其扩展机制开发自己的插件。这纯粹是基于标准Django应用程序的开发(应用程序),以及与Django-CMS的集成。

  尽管Django-CMS提供的功能不大,但它提供了一个非常好的基础架构,从而使开发人员可以快速构建产品。从这个角度来看,它似乎更适合增强的Django。

  第一步是安装Django:

  下载软件包:django-0.96.1.tar.gz

  解压缩此软件包:tar zxf django -0.96.1.tar.gz -c

  /usr/tmp

  安装:

  CD /USR /TMP

  CD Django-0.96.1

  su

  python setup.py安装

  检查安装是否正确:

  Python

  导入django

  django.version

  (0,96.0999999999994,无)

  第二步是安装mysql:

  下载软件包:mysql-5.1.23-rc.tar.gz

  十年:tar zxf mysql-5.1.23-rc.tar.gz -c

  /usr/tmp

  安装:

  Shell GroupDD mysql

  shell userAdd -G mysql mysql

  炮弹枪

  壳CD mysql-version

  shell https://www.shouxicto.com/article/configure

  -prefix =/usr/local/mysql

  壳制造

  此步骤将需要一段时间,您可以选择吃饭,但不要吃得太快。

  外壳安装

  Shell CP支持文件/my- medium.cnf

  /etc/my.cnf

  Shell CD/USR/local/mysql

  外壳Chown -R mysql。

  Shell CHGRP -R mysql。

  shell bin/mysql_install_db -user = mysql

  外壳chow -r根。

  外壳Chown -R mysql var

  shell bin/mysqld_safe -user = mysql

  cp/usr/local/mysql/lib/mysql/libmysqlient.so.16

  /usr/lib/。

  cp/usr/local/mysql/lib/mysql/libmysqlly_r.so.16

  /usr/lib/。

  步骤3安装Apache

  下载软件包:

  httpd-2.2.8.tar.gz

  疏忽:

  tar zxf httpd -2.2.8.tar.gz -c

  /usr/tmp

  安装:

  https://www.shouxicto.com/article/configure

  -prefix =/usr/local/httpd

  制作

  进行安装

  步骤4安装mod_python

  下载软件包:

  mod_python-3.3.1.tgz

  疏忽:

  tar zxf mod_python -3.3.1.tgz -c

  /usr/tmp

  安装:

  https://www.shouxicto.com/article/configure

  -with-apxs =/usr/local/httpd/bin/apxs

  制作

  进行安装

  步骤5安装mysqldb

  下载软件包:

  mysql -python -.2.2.2.tar.gz

  setuptools-0.6c5-py2.4.egg

  疏忽:

  tar zxf mysql -python -.2.2.2.tar.gz

  -c /usr /tmp

  CP setuptools-0.6c5-py2.4.egg

  /usr/tmp/mysql -python -.2.2

  安装:

  光盘

  /usr/tmp/mysql -python -.2.2

  python setup.py build

  su

  python setup.py安装

  CHMOD 644

  /root/.python-eggs/mysql_python-1.2.2-py2.4-linux- i686.egg-tmp/_mysql.so

  安装几乎是这样的。

  Wenxing超级写作助理4.0

  “ Wen Xing Super写作助理”是一组功能性且相当实用的写作辅助软件。(1)该系统提供了大约500万文文字的巨大语言材料库,包括词汇,说明图书馆,唐诗和歌曲,名人名称图书馆,谚语库,古代文本名称库,Xieyu语言库,精美的示例文本图书馆的八个数据库采用科学和详细的分类(500个类别)系统,并通过关键字查询方法补充。用户可以快速,方便地找到他们为自己的写作所需写的精彩词汇,句子,部分和论文。(2)该系统可以帮助用户构建自己的语言材料库,他们也可以快速找到他们。通常取货并拿起小书的朋友可以扔掉您的小书。(3)此系统还包括“提交地址”,“提交管理系统”,“地址”,“注释”和“中国词典”“,“习惯词典”,“ CI Lenovo词典”,“ Devil的词典”,因此是实用的工具。该系统非常适合写作的爱好者和小学和中学生的朋友!” Wen Xing!产生文学!

  研究生写作助理2.0

  当秘书秘书暂时写文章时,办公室是密不可分的。但是,许多人担心,因为他们无法撰写文章。实际上,有很多技巧可以撰写文章。最重要的是要学会模仿,然后您可以熟悉巧合并撰写精美的文章。这本电子书累积了编写文章多年的经验,这不仅提供了各种行政,经济的写作点,法律,礼节,事物和新闻文章,但还提供了各种官方文件的示例和模型。:这本书提供了数百个例子。对于初学者,您可以使用复制和粘性帖子的方法来快速撰写文章。它被称为:以该软件为助手,写作不再担心。

  您可以使用django-cms进行。这是一个非常完整的基于Django的站点构建系统。您可以在主页上下载

  如果您安装PIP,则可以使用以下命令直接安装Django-CMS软件包。

  PIP安装Django Django-CMS

  1.检查是否安装了Python:直接在外壳中输入Python。如果您已经安装了Python,则可以输入Python Bash并查看版本号(例如Python 2.7.3) -

  结论:以上是CTO主要CTO的所有内容,都指出了如何将Django-CMS用于每个人。感谢您花时间阅读此网站。我希望这对您有帮助。有关如何使用django-cms的更多信息,请在此站点上找到它。